Very nice graph
Just look at what happened with solar investment - it’s astonishing.

Solar has seen the most rapid investment growth, soaring from $142 billion in 2015 to a projected $441 billion this year.

Today, we welcome the Council's adoption of the 18th sanctions package against Russia for its continued illegal war in Ukraine.

This package intensifies pressure on the banking, energy, and military-industrial sectors, while implementing a newly designed, dynamic oil price cap↓
